Choosing a Name for Your LLC

Choosing a name for our LLC is an important step that not only reflects our brand but also complies with Tennessee's legal requirements. We must guarantee that our chosen name is unique and distinguishable from existing businesses in the state. This means exploring creative name ideas that resonate with our mission while adhering to specific legal name restrictions.

In Tennessee, our LLC name must include "Limited Liability Company," "LLC," or "L.L.C." Additionally, certain words may be prohibited or require approval, such as "bank" or "insurance." As we brainstorm potential names, it's vital to conduct a thorough search through the Tennessee Secretary of State's database to avoid conflicts.

Ultimately, a well-chosen name will not only fulfill legal obligations but also establish a strong identity within our community, fostering a sense of belonging for both us and our future customers.

Role of Registered Agent

A registered agent plays an essential role in the formation and maintenance of an LLC in Tennessee. This individual or entity is responsible for receiving important legal documents, such as service of process and official correspondence from the state. Their reliability is vital, as it guarantees we stay informed about any legal obligations or compliance requirements. When considering agent selection criteria, we should look for someone with a physical address in Tennessee, availability during business hours, and a proven track record of dependability. By carefully evaluating these registered agent responsibilities, we foster a solid foundation for our LLC, promoting transparency and trust in our business operations. Ultimately, this choice supports our commitment to adhering to Tennessee's legal standards.

Filing Requirements in Tennessee

When establishing our LLC in Tennessee, understanding the filing requirements is essential, particularly regarding the appointment of a registered agent. A registered agent serves as our LLC's official point of contact for legal and tax documents, ensuring compliance with state regulations. We must designate a registered agent in our Articles of Organization, which includes providing their name and address. It's vital to meet the documentation requirements accurately to avoid processing delays. Additionally, we need to be aware of the filing fees associated with submitting the Articles of Organization. By carefully fulfilling these requirements, we position our LLC for success and demonstrate our commitment to operating within the legal framework of Tennessee.

Creating an Operating Agreement

Although we’ve successfully filed the Articles of Organization, creating an Operating Agreement is equally important for our LLC in Tennessee. This document serves as the backbone of our business, outlining member responsibilities and ensuring clarity in our operations.

When drafting clauses, we should focus on key aspects such as the management structure, profit distribution, and procedures for adding or removing members. It’s vital that we clearly define each member's role to prevent misunderstandings and maintain harmony within the team.

In addition, we should include provisions for resolving disputes, which can safeguard our LLC’s integrity. By collaboratively crafting this agreement, we solidify our commitment to one another and create a framework that supports our shared vision. Ultimately, an Operating Agreement not only protects our individual interests but also reinforces our collective goals, fostering a sense of belonging and unity as we commence on this entrepreneurial journey together.

Understanding Tax Obligations

Understanding our tax obligations is vital for the successful operation of our LLC in Tennessee. By familiarizing ourselves with both state and federal taxes, we can guarantee compliance and avoid penalties. It's essential to know that our LLC may be subject to various taxes, including:

  • Franchise Tax: A tax imposed on the privilege of doing business in Tennessee.
  • Sales Tax: Required for any retail sales we make within the state.
  • Annual Taxes: Regular obligations we must fulfill to maintain our LLC status.
  • Estimated Taxes: Payments we might need to make quarterly, depending on our income.

Additionally, we should explore available tax deductions and credits that can alleviate our overall tax burden. By understanding these components, we can better manage our financial responsibilities, fostering a thriving business environment for our LLC.

Maintaining Your LLC's Compliance

While we may be enthusiastic to launch our LLC in Tennessee, maintaining compliance with state regulations is crucial for our business's longevity. One of our primary responsibilities is to file annual reports with the Tennessee Secretary of State. This guarantees that our LLC remains in good standing and avoids penalties or dissolution. We’ll want to be diligent in submitting these reports, typically due each year on the first day of the anniversary month of our LLC's formation.

Additionally, we should hold regular member meetings to discuss our business's direction and important decisions. Documenting these meetings through minutes can further solidify our commitment to transparency and governance, which can be beneficial should any legal inquiries arise.
